Output 3983f68396334e85a438b710d50e1942be2ec177355dc92a006e8390bb6e4762:0

value
21075511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35fc7ab3d62f905f276e3bc5b9dbf3b914027bed OP_EQUAL
address
MCpcWAdvLgc4WybQfsdWmSuPdzeYsFkRRJ
transaction
3983f68396334e85a438b710d50e1942be2ec177355dc92a006e8390bb6e4762
spent
true